A digest is an email delivered to your inbox on a schedule — weekly, daily, or hourly. It contains a summary of your recent GitHub commits: a narrative of what you shipped, key themes, highlights, and a breakdown by repo. You don't have to do anything once it's set up.

PRO gives you weekly and daily digests across up to 10 repos — more than enough for most developers. Unlimited adds hourly digests and scales up to 25 repos per digest, for engineers who want the most current picture of their activity.
We fetch your recent commits from GitHub, group them by theme, and produce a human-readable narrative. Your code is never stored — commit data is only processed during summary generation and immediately discarded. No setup required on your end.
Free: 3 repos per digest. PRO: 10 repos. Unlimited: 25 repos. RepoSweeper (the repo manager) has no limits on any plan.
